No explorer.exe?!
All of a sudden, I can't open an explorer window by invoking
explorer.exe. The shortcut in start menu does nothing, nor does typing
"explorer.exe" in from "Run..." or the command line. Even doing c:
\windows\explorer.exe does nothing.

I can still open specific directories by using the directory name in a
shortcut or "start" command. But all the features that you get from
the explorer command line (I'm a particular fan of "/e,/
root,somthing") are now unavailable. Damned nuisance.

I think this started with the latest MS update.
